  • Abstract
    In performing complex tasks, very often, we recur to rules. In following rules we can recognize the general paradigm "given a condition do an action". We can code, in a given formal language, the above paradigm as a conditional statement like "if A then B", where A forms a conditional part, while B is the action part of the rule. In such a way, we can formalize knowledge based system and rule based system, in some formal language. When such rule based systems face with imprecise phenomena, it seems natural to use the formalism of fuzzy set theory. We refer to them as fuzzy rule based system
